Swiss Papal guardsFor over 500 years the faithful Swiss Guard have been serving the papacy. Today they still stand tall in their uniforms in front of St. Peter’s Cathedral in Rome as symbolic protectors of the Pope.

No other Swiss municipality over the centuries has contributed more Guards than Naters. For this reason the historian Wener Bellwald decided to open a museum in their honour in the old military fortress above the town.
